7.2 Remote I/O Control When an Error Occurs

The operation can be selected when an error occurs on [MEWNET-F].
Two types of error may occur in the remote I/O system.
Communication error
The master station and any slave station cannot communicate with each other. This may occur because
the slave station is not turned on, or the communication cable may not be wired correctly.
Error occurs in the unit connected to a slave station system
When an input/output unit or advanced unit connected to the system where a slave unit is installed has
produced an error because of a unit hangs or a system error, the error is detected.
You can check the operaiton status when an error occurs by examining the combination of the system
registers in the CPU and the mode selector switches on the master unit.
